Decision Architecture
The Clarity Spectrum™
A framework for diagnosing where procurement decisions actually break down
Most procurement failures are not strategy failures. They are clarity failures: moments where the decision existed, but the conditions for executing it did not. The Clarity Spectrum maps four progressive levels between raw information and the clarity that produces action, and diagnoses where organisations lose their way between them.
Leadership Alignment
Three-Lens Evaluation Model
A framework for seeing complex decisions through the perspectives that actually matter
Strategic decisions often fail because different stakeholders are working from different realities. The Three-Lens Evaluation Model helps leaders assess initiatives through operational reality, transformation feasibility, and strategic value. The result is stronger alignment before decisions move into execution.
Operating Model Design
The Adaptive Operating Matrix
A framework for matching operating models to complexity, risk, and responsiveness
Procurement and supply chain environments do not all require the same operating model. The Adaptive Operating Matrix helps leaders determine where standardisation, flexibility, governance, and responsiveness are required. It provides a structured approach to designing operating models that fit the reality of the business.
